Being assaulted with his family| Civilian dies affected by wounds sustained in Al-Suwaydaa

 

Al-Suwaydaa province: SOHR activists have documented the death of a civilian affected by the wounds he sustained yesterday, where he was shot along with his family by an armed group in a “Van” on the highway between Damascus and Al-Suwaydaa, while the rest of his family comprising his wife and three of his children are receiving proper medication in the hospital.

Yesterday, SOHR activists documented the injury of a family comprising a man, his wife and three of his children with two of them being severely injured, where an armed group in a “Van” car opened fire on the family on the highway between Damascus and Al-Suwaydaa.

Reliable sources informed SOHR that unidentified gunmen intercepted a car carrying a civilian and his family near Al-Shahba city on Damascus-Al-Suwaydaa road, getting him and his family out of the car, taking him to an unknown destination and setting his car on fire.

It is worth noting that Al-Suwaydaa province in southern Syria is experiencing insecurity chaos in light of lack of surveillance and accountability.
